B.
Maintenance
1.
Change the oil when the pump has been used for the first 30~50 hours.
2.
After the initial oil change, replace the oil after every 100~200 hours of
operation.
3.
Use #30~40 oil, add 70 cc
each time.
C.
Troubleshooting
1.
UNSTABLE WORKING PRESSURE
(a)
Check whether the suction hose is leaking, clogged or afloat.
(b)
Drain out the redundant air by disconnecting the outlet hose.
(c)
Check the valve assembly to see if it is clogged or damaged.(1)
2.
INSUFFICIENT PRESSURE
(a)
Check to see if the packing, waterproof seal(3) and valve assembly(1) are
damaged.
(b)
Check to see if the pressure valve and regulating spring are worn out.(2)
3.
LEAKAGE
(a)
Check the U-Packing, waterproof seal and piston. Replace them if
necessary.(3)
